Series Key Verse:

“A final word: Be strong in the Lord and in his mighty power. Put on all of God’s armor so that you will be able to stand firm against all strategies of the devil.” Ephesians 6:10-11 (p.898)

  • My Faith Is Worth Fighting For.

To be prepared:

  1. Recognize the fight.

“The thief’s purpose is to steal and kill and destroy. My purpose is to give them a rich and satisfying life.” John 10:10 (p.819)

“David asked the soldiers standing nearby…’Who is this pagan Philistine anyway, that he is allowed to defy the armies of the living God?’” 1 Samuel 17:26 (p.224)

  1. Be combat ready.

“Physical training is good, but training for godliness is much better, promising benefits in this life and in the life to come.” 1 Timothy 4:8 (p.911)

“’Don’t worry about this Philistine,’ David told Saul. ‘I’ll go fight him!’” 1 Samuel 17:32 (p.224) 

  1. Be strong in the Lord.

“Be strong in the Lord and in his mighty power.”  Ephesians 6:10 (p.898)

(David) “’You come to me with sword, spear, and javelin, but I come to you in the name of the Lord of Heaven’s Armies—the God of the armies of Israel, whom you have defied.” 1 Samuel 17:45 (p.224)

“’(Jesus)…I have told you all this so that you may have peace in me. Here on earth you will have many trials and sorrows. But take heart, because I have overcome the world.’” John 16:33 (p.825)

    • Read Ephesians 6:10-11 (p.898*). Also be ready to look at portions of 1 Samuel 17:12-51 (p.224*)
      • Talk about the imagery that the author, Paul, uses in Ephesians 6. Why do you think he uses it?
      • People in the military, law enforcement, construction, and health care (with PPE: Personal Protective Equipment), need the right protection. Why is proper protection important?
    • Jeff and Steve discussed three ways to be prepared to fight for your faith:
  • Recognize the Fight. (John 10:10 (p.819*) 1 Samuel 17:21-26 (p.224*)
    • Why is it important to do this?
    • Have you ever found yourself in a fight for which you were unprepared? What happened?
    • In 1 Samuel 17, what was causing the Israelite army to not advance?
    • How was David’s response to seeing Goliath different from the rest of the army’s response?
  • Be Combat Ready. (1 Timothy 4:8 (p.911*) and 1 Samuel 17:32-37 (p.224*))
    • What is “training in godliness?” How do you do that? What has helped you train this way?
    • What are these “benefits” Paul speaks of in his letter to his protégé, Timothy?
    • He had not specifically trained for warfare, so how was David “combat ready?”
    • What did David cite as his ultimate source of readiness? What do you need to be ready for?

(3) Be Strong in the Lord. (Ephesians 6:10 (p.898*) and 1 Samuel 17:45-47 (p.224*))

  • What does it mean to be strong “in the Lord?”
  • Do you feel strong today? When have you felt the strongest? The weakest? What made these two extremes different for you?
  • With what did David come at Goliath? What offense did David say Goliath had committed?
  • Who did David say would be the conqueror? Who’s battle did David say this was? Why?
